Khawhpawp Falls
Khawhpawp, a small waterfall in Aizawl is one of the best natural treasures Aizawl has to offer. Its beauty is the reason that will attract you. Khawhpawp is the best place to sneak out with friends and families during weekends.

Muthi Park
One of best parks in Aizawl, it is located in Muthi village which is about 15 minutes drive from Aizawl. Great place for family hang outs, weekend getaway

Aizawl Zoological Park
The Aizwal Zoo is a miniature zoo that can be found in the Bethlehem Vengthlang neighborhood. It is home to a number of the most endangered species of birds, mammals, and other animals known to science. In addition, the typical creatures that inhabit the area can be found in large numbers. A particular highlight of the Aizwal Zoo, which is a center of attraction for people of all ages, is the sun bear, which is the species that has been identified as being the most endangered in India. The Zoological Park is maintained by the Forest Department of Govt. of Mizoram.

Thasiama Seno-neihna
Thasiama se no neihna hi tlangbawk sang tak, khawkrawk tak leh mihring tan pawh kal harsa khawp a ni a, Vaphai khawdaia awm a ni. He tlangbawk chhipah hian Thasiama sial (Mithun) hian no a nei a, sial chu sawi loh mihring tan pawh a kal harsa anih avangin mak tih a hlawh hle a, tlawhtu pawh a ngah thei hle a ni. Thawnthu a alan dan chuan hetianga mihring pawh kal theih mang lohna hmuna sialin no a han neih theihna chhan chu Thasiama hi lasi (Fairy) nula Chawngtinleri nen an inzawl a, Chawngtinleri hian thasiama chu malsawmin seno tam tak neiturin mal a sawm a, chuvang chuan he sial pawh hi chawngtinlerin a hruai a ni an ti.

Mizoram State Museum
A museum that was constructed in 1977, the museum is an ethnographic museum that displays objects that serve multiple purposes. There are five galleries, which are devoted to the following subjects: textiles, ethnology, history, anthropology, natural history, and ethnography. The extensive culture of Mizo life is portrayed in each and every collection. A number of other aspects, such as the way of life of the indigenous people, their dwellings, clothing, weaponry, tools, modes of transportation, culinary styles, educational practices, and so on, are also displayed through the museum’s collection of artifacts. In addition, the museum contains several areas that are specifically designated for the presentation of a variety of plant and animal species
